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60283835 807 40611954 081727966
87162762 6313 51625658
87162762 6313 51625658
804930 13977 96598393284
All about undefined
Interested in learning more?
87162762 6313 51625658
804930 13977 96598393284
See more
396 4270494 00380717
39821 22250926937 9463174617
See more
615733 7870531
274 508125772 198012 49 41965
See more